Reproduction of fireproof bricks and the interior of a melting furnace! A case of creating a 1/5 scale polystyrene model.
We would like to introduce a case of creating a polystyrene model of the "World Heritage" Nirayama Reverberatory Furnace. A polystyrene model at a 1/5 scale (height 3.1m) of the "World Heritage" Nirayama Reverberatory Furnace (a nationally designated historic site) was produced. We also recreated the fireproof bricks and the interior of the melting furnace. The model was installed at an event (exhibition) during the 2016 World Foundry Conference and was donated to Izunokuni City. Kimura Casting Co., Ltd. is a company that primarily manufactures various types of cast iron, cast steel, and various special alloy castings. In 1966, we introduced the Full Mold Casting (FMC) method, which clearly highlighted both its advantages and disadvantages, making it challenging to overcome the drawbacks. However, after many changes, we abandoned the casting methods we had developed up to that point and specialized in this Full Mold Casting method. This focus and continuity have supported our company today, enabling new business developments. This technology also pairs well with digital technology, and supported by model production using it, we take pride in having brought about revolutionary changes in casting within a broad industrial sector.
